CUSTOM STAR WARS VANS PAINTING STAGE 01

Here’s a look at my painting process for a pair of custom shoes featuring Darth Sidious/Emperor. Painting process one starts with taping off both shoes so I can paint the star fields first before working on the image of the Emperor.

The star field is achieved using Liquitex free style brushes. I love these brushes because they give such a great random splatter effect.

After using the Liquitex free style brushes to create the star field, I moved on to adding a glow to various stars and adding bursts around the shoes. Then I painted in the main white base shape of the Emperor on both shoes. Once that dried overnight, I put down the pencils and then outlined the Emperor for each shoe.

THE BATMAN PAINTING EXPERIMENT

I started on this Batman piece recently. It’s painted on black illustration board. In high school this was one of my favorite types of illustration, but back then I used colored pencils to render the subject. it’s great to experiment with this type of illustration using acrylics this time.
